Evaluating the Strength and Validity of Copyright Registrations
Evaluating the strength and validity of copyright registrations involves several critical considerations. It begins with verifying that the registration was properly filed with the appropriate authority and that all procedural requirements were met. Proper documentation enhances the legitimacy and enforceability of the copyright.
Assessing the content’s originality and factual accuracy is also vital. A strong registration should clearly demonstrate that the work is original and that the claimant holds the rights. Ambiguous or incomplete descriptions may weaken the overall validity of the registration.
Another key factor is reviewing the timeline. Confirming registration dates and any subsequent renewals helps establish priority rights and whether the copyright remains in effect. Accurate dating can influence legal defenses during infringement disputes.
Finally, examining the scope of rights granted and any limitations recorded in the registration ensures that the registration’s claims align with the actual work. Proper evaluation here supports informed decisions in IP audits and strategic planning.

Challenges and Limitations in Analyzing Copyright Registrations
Analyzing copyright registrations presents several challenges, primarily due to inconsistent or incomplete data reporting. Variability in registration details can hinder accurate trend identification and comparison. Reliability of data sources remains a concern, as some databases may contain outdated or erroneous information.
Another significant limitation is the potential for bias or misclassification. Copyright registration data may reflect legal or procedural inconsistencies, making it difficult to draw definitive conclusions. Regulatory differences across jurisdictions further complicate cross-border analysis.
Technical challenges also impact analysis efforts. Data volume can be overwhelming, requiring sophisticated tools and expertise to process efficiently. Software limitations or lack of access to proprietary databases may restrict comprehensive analysis, affecting the accuracy of findings.
Lastly, ethical considerations must be acknowledged. Ensuring privacy compliance and maintaining non-bias in analysis are essential, yet can be difficult to enforce strictly. These challenges highlight the importance of cautious interpretation when analyzing copyright registrations within IP audits.
